How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 47906?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 47906 Studio Apartments | $1,438 | $565 | $2,060 |
| 47906 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,607 | $499 | $3,296 |
| 47906 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,804 | $565 | $3,454 |
| 47906 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,638 | $533 | $3,600 |
| 47906 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,451 | $499 | $2,390 |
